Sisters of Perpetual Indulgence stage pro-drag demonstration this weekend

The Orlando Sisters of Perpetual Indulgence, a nonprofit “dedicated to the promulgation of omniversal joy and the expiation of stigmatic guilt,” are back at long last — and they’re inviting community members to stand in solidarity with Orlando’s drag community at Lake Eola.

The Sisters are planning a drag-themed demonstration/gathering in protest of anti-LGBTQ laws passed by the Florida Legislature recently, including a law targeting drag that has already led to the cancellation of Pride events in Tampa and the Treasure Coast. Orlando’s Hamburger Mary’s has sued over the law, which owners say has already affected their business.
